Transaction 1664e4767e3086ae3cc23ce8c95842638050120608d7d0bafdc6de19ebf3d595
1 Input
1 Output
-
1664e4767e3086ae3cc23ce8c95842638050120608d7d0bafdc6de19ebf3d595:0
- value
- 95640
- script pubkey
- OP_0 OP_PUSHBYTES_32 3a5b4f35ad3e6c6e40a2b9a2170cedfffde94e437656be72b21745bcb6cd6dda
- address
- bc1q8fd57ddd8ekxus9zhx3pwr8dll77jnjrwettuu4jzazmedkddhdqn2hefu